Output 1ae98251d80207bbc6d9795a22b3aebace4a672a5701e156d9fb444db02bfb21:0

value
20794738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43ccae1d790c6ad4688f7b1dd0b27b0f29849c14 OP_EQUAL
address
37sWPpcGKWbQp4fdqPW21dki63ejefrSqR
transaction
1ae98251d80207bbc6d9795a22b3aebace4a672a5701e156d9fb444db02bfb21
confirmations
33091
spent
true